What Makes Natural Diamond Engagement Rings Special?
A natural diamond engagement ring features a diamond formed through natural geological processes over billions of years. Unlike lab-created stones, natural diamonds are rare treasures shaped by time and pressure within the earth.
Their rarity, durability, and brilliance make them the traditional and enduring choice for engagement rings. Each natural diamond has unique characteristics — inclusions, clarity patterns, and light performance — that give it individuality and charm.
For many couples, choosing a natural diamond ring represents authenticity, heritage, and timeless value.
Popular Styles of Natural Diamond Engagement Rings
Natural Diamond Solitaire Engagement Rings
The most iconic design, a natural diamond solitaire ring, features a single center stone that maximizes brilliance and elegance. This classic setting highlights the diamond’s beauty without distraction.
Solitaire engagement rings are ideal for those who prefer clean lines and timeless sophistication.
Halo Natural Diamond Engagement Rings
Halo natural diamond rings feature a center diamond surrounded by a circle of smaller diamonds. This design enhances sparkle and creates the illusion of a larger center stone.
Halo engagement rings are popular for brides who love glamour and brilliance.
Three-Stone Natural Diamond Rings
The three-stone engagement ring symbolizes the past, present, and future of a relationship. This design features a center diamond with two side stones for added brilliance and meaning.
Vintage & Classic Natural Diamond Rings
Vintage-inspired engagement rings often include intricate details such as milgrain edges, pavé bands, and antique settings. These designs offer romantic charm and timeless beauty.
Choosing the Right Natural Diamond
When selecting a natural diamond engagement ring, understanding the 4Cs is essential:
Cut
The cut determines how well the diamond reflects light. Excellent or ideal cuts provide maximum brilliance.
Color
Natural diamonds range from colorless to slightly tinted. Colorless diamonds are rare and highly valued.
Clarity
Clarity refers to internal inclusions and surface imperfections. Higher clarity grades indicate fewer visible inclusions.
Carat Weight
Carat measures the size of the diamond. Larger stones are rarer and often more valuable.
Certified natural diamonds are graded by reputable gemological laboratories to ensure authenticity and quality.

Caring for Natural Diamond Engagement Rings
To maintain brilliance:
- Clean regularly with mild soap and warm water
- Avoid harsh chemicals
- Remove during heavy physical activities
- Schedule annual professional inspections
Proper care ensures your natural diamond ring remains beautiful for generations.
